Don’t underestimate pine as a great mulch. Some plants are more acidic, and prefer soil that contains higher acidic levels. For these types of plants, pine needles are wonderful for mulching. Spread a few inches of pine needles on your organic beds so that it will put the acid into your soil.

Try using coffee grounds on the soil. Coffee grounds are filled with nutritional elements plants need, such as nitrogen. Many times, nitrogen is a limiting nutrient in soils. Adding coffee grounds or compost can add nitrogen to your soils will help your plants grow tall and healthy.

Paying attention to spacing is important. Many people don’t realize exactly how much space a plant needs when it grows. The plants will inevitably need to unfurl and spread, but they also need the circulation of air from open spaces. Plan accordingly and put an appropriate amount of distance between seeds.

Within your composting heap, ensure that there is an equal split of dried and green plant materials. Garden wastes, such as grass clippings, are classified as green materials. Dried material includes straw, shredded paper, and cardboard. Do not include charcoal, ashes, meat, carnivorous animal manure or diseased plants.

If you are planting seeds in containers, a good rule of thumb is that the seed’s depth should be around three times its overall size. Certain seeds are an exception to that rule, since they require sunlight to germinate, so they should be barely covered or not at all. Petunia and ageratum seeds need direct sunlight, for example. If you are not sure whether your seeds need to be exposed to sunlight, resources are usually provided with the seeds or can be found online.

If slugs are disrupting the balance of your garden, you can diminish their population by using a beer trap. Place a jar into the soil so that the top of it’s mouth rests parallel with the soil. Now, fill the jar with beer to approximately an inch below the lip. Slugs are attracted to the beer and become trapped in the container.

Ensure you thoroughly inspect your roof at least yearly. Spring and winter are times when damage is prevalent. Therefore, make sure you pay attention to your roof at these times.

Don’t procrastinate replacing worn or broken shingles. While you may believe it is okay to put off a roof repair, you will only further the damage by prolonging it. Taking care of shingles right away can save you a lot of money and stress. Your roof will last longer if it is maintained well.

When fixing a leak, it’s important to do the job right the first time around. The first spot may not be all there is in need of repair. Check over the whole roof so that you can see if there are more problems that you’re going to have to take care of.

Do not make changes to your roof that are not long-term. Although you may think you can save some money, this will likely cause further damage to your roof, causing you to spend even more money. Fix any issues promptly and properly to ensure that the problem does not worsen down the line.

When hiring a contractor, be sure they they are experts in their field. Friends and neighbors who have recently had work done on their roofs may have recommendations for you. Referrals can help you avoid getting an inferior roof installed, along with the cost and frustration of correcting the mistakes.

Sometimes a contractor with his own workers can be more cost effective than a contractor who has no workers. Several roofers can get things done faster, which may also lower the cost. If you have one doing it alone, be sure they’re not overcharging for labor.

Your roof’s age can indicate if it needs replacing. Most roofs need to be replaced about every 20 years. When your current roof is a second layer on top of your old roof, it has to be replaced after 20 years.

If you’re wondering if your roof is leaking, try spraying it with a garden hose. You will then be able to see any leaks that exist and assess the damaged areas. It is simple and much cheaper than hiring someone to check for you.

Never skimp in terms of roofing materials. Although it is possible to obtain cheap materials, they are often lower quality. As a result, they will likely wear out sooner, which means you will have to replace them more often. This can cost you even more money than simply purchasing more expensive, but higher quality, materials.
